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2007.02.04;
Скачать: CL | DM;

Вниз

Из MySQL в XML   Найти похожие ветки 

 
Артем_   (2006-11-15 10:27) [0]

Добрый день!
Загружаю в ClientDataset данные из cds-файла:
...
cdsMySql.LoadFromFile("file.cds");
...

Необходимо сохранить их в XML:
...
cdsMySql.SaveToFile("file.xml");
...


Результат: значения строковых и текстовых полей интересным образом стали абсолютно нечитаемые.
Делаю то же самое при помощи XMLMapper - все отлично.
Подскажите, что я не так делаю?


 
clickmaker ©   (2006-11-15 10:32) [1]


> стали абсолютно нечитаемые

то есть?


 
Артем_   (2006-11-15 10:36) [2]

=> clickmaker ©   (15.11.06 10:32) [1]

Кодировка изменилась или какая-то другая причина.


 
clickmaker ©   (2006-11-15 10:38) [3]

а 2-й параметр в SaveToFile?


 
Артем_   (2006-11-15 10:47) [4]

Пробовал все три параметра и без параметра тоже, результат один и тот же.


 
clickmaker ©   (2006-11-15 10:49) [5]


> результат один и тот же

странно... что нет разницы между просто XML и XMLUtf8? Какая кстати кодировка в базе?


 
Артем_   (2006-11-15 11:00) [6]

Нет, ну разница в выводе есть конечно, но мне без разницы, одни закорячки выводятся или другие, мне нужен русский текст в текстовых полях, как он есть в выгруженном CDS-файле.
В базе MySQL кодировка 1251.


 
clickmaker ©   (2006-11-15 11:18) [7]

ну может не совсем красивое решение, но сохрани в StringStream в XML UTF-8, а потом Utf8ToAnsi()



Страницы: 1 вся ветка

Текущий архив: 2007.02.04;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.635 c
2-1169158460
AlexeyT
2007-01-19 01:14
2007.02.04
Печать TImage/TBitmap?


15-1168727245
ProgRAMmer Dimonych
2007-01-14 01:27
2007.02.04
И снова об XP и Vista


15-1168936703
NLex
2007-01-16 11:38
2007.02.04
Login в DLL


15-1168543701
ArtemESC
2007-01-11 22:28
2007.02.04
Так и не понял Паскаля...


2-1169127279
Кевларвестов Семен
2007-01-18 16:34
2007.02.04
TReader не читает из TMemoryStream